Driver in Jeep Rollover Crash Charged with DUI

Scott Township police said they plan to charge the driver involved in the rollover crash last week near Vanadium Road with DUI.

Police said Paul Herstek, 27, of Sharpsburg, was driving under the influence when he crashed his shortly before 11 p.m. on Aug. 24 near the Bower Hill Volunteer Fire Department.

Herstek was injured in the crash and taken to an area hospital. Police did not say how seriously he was injured.

Herstek also faces charges of marijuana possession, other drug law violations and accident involving damage.

Police plan to send a summons with the charges in the mail to Herstek.
